Thousands Of Glastonbury Festivalgoers Arrive Early
Glastonbury music fans are continuing to plough onto the
Worthy Farm site this afternoon in a bid to pitch their tents in the
best spots.
Although the festival doesn’t get underway officially until
tomorrow (June 22), 97,000 people had already passed through the
Festival’s doors by 9am this morning (June 21).
Travelling to the festival this morning, the only traffic
problems Gigwise encountered was the Summer Solstice celebrations at
Stonehenge – with hundred’s of hippies celebrating the longest day of
the year.
